The Minister of Education announced it today. It is not yet known whether the president has accepted the resignation. Three other members of the powerful Rajapaksa family were among the ministers who tendered their resignations. They managed the Finance, Agriculture and Sports portfolios. The president declared a state of emergency in Sri Lanka on Saturday after days of protests and …

updateHungarian nationalist Prime Minister Viktor Orbán claims a “great victory” in Sunday’s legislative elections. With more than half of the votes counted, his party Fidesz is at 58%, against 30% for an alliance of six opposition parties. Opposition Leader Peter Marki-Zay admitted his loss. Addressing a jubilant crowd that chanted his name, Orbán said: “We have won a great victory …

In 2022, sabotage is not just taking place on the ground. Much of the rail warfare is waged by “Cyberpartisans”, a group of 35 hackers who shut down entire systems or infect them with ransomware. “This is how we stop the Russian advance. We cannot prevent arms deliveries, but we can significantly delay them,” Yuliana Shemetovets said. She works from …
